New York-based recruiting software services provider Greenhouse, has named Indian-American tech executive Sagar Patel as its chief technology officer.
Working alongside chief product officer Meredith Johnson, Patel will focus on restructuring the product development lifecycle to anticipate evolving hiring needs. He also aims to leverage agentic AI software to streamline recruitment while preserving human decision-making in hiring.

Commenting on his new role, Patel said, "Hiring technical talent is never easy. The only times I've felt confident during the recruitment process were when I was a hiring manager using the Greenhouse platform. Now that I've joined Greenhouse as CTO, I'm looking forward to working on products that solve the recruitment problems that I've faced personally, at a company I believe in."
Patel previously served as head of engineering for revolving credit products at PayPal, where he managed global product development for high-volume credit and payment services. As CTO at Ampla, he helped introduce banking services and credit products, while earlier in his career he scaled engineering teams at BlackRock and Lunchbox.
"Sagar's sharp approach to technology is exactly what we want at Greenhouse as we continue to develop software that balances AI technology advances with human decision-making. This is an exciting time of growth for Greenhouse as we're launching new products, expanding globally, and onboarding larger customers. Sagar's leadership will help drive our mission and goals forward,” said Daniel Chait, co-founder and CEO of Greenhouse.
Greenhouse serves more than 7,500 companies worldwide, offering tools to improve hiring outcomes through structured, data-driven recruitment processes.
